If I'm not mistaken, the term S-Line merely refers to a trim package and does not necessarily come with any performance gains over a standard A3. The Audi performance naming standard would be an S3 if it were something mechanically above and beyond a standard A3. It appears from the pictures and description on the listing that it is a genuine S-Line A3 but I am not an expert.
